如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

深入解析 current timestamp:时间戳在现代应用中的重要性

深入解析 current timestamp:时间戳在现代应用中的重要性

在当今数字化时代,时间戳(timestamp)扮演着至关重要的角色。特别是 current timestamp,它不仅记录了当前的日期和时间,还在许多领域中发挥着不可或缺的作用。本文将为大家详细介绍 current timestamp 的概念、应用及其在日常生活和工作中的重要性。

current timestamp 的定义

current timestamp 指的是系统当前的日期和时间,通常以标准格式(如ISO 8601)表示。例如,2023-10-05T14:30:00Z 就是一个典型的 current timestamp。这个时间戳不仅包含了年、月、日、时、分、秒,还可能包含毫秒或微秒级别的精度。

current timestamp 的获取方式

在不同的编程语言和数据库系统中,获取 current timestamp 的方法各有不同:

  • SQL:在大多数数据库中,可以使用 CURRENT_TIMESTAMPNOW() 函数来获取当前时间戳。
  • JavaScript:可以使用 Date.now()new Date().toISOString() 来获取当前时间戳。
  • Python:通过 datetime 模块的 datetime.now() 方法可以获取当前时间戳。

current timestamp 的应用

  1. 日志记录:在系统日志中,current timestamp 用于记录事件发生的准确时间,帮助开发者和管理员追踪问题和分析系统行为。

  2. 数据同步:在分布式系统中,current timestamp 用于确保数据的一致性和同步性。例如,在多台服务器之间同步数据时,时间戳可以帮助确定数据的更新顺序。

  3. 安全认证:在安全领域,current timestamp 用于生成一次性密码(OTP)或验证会话的有效性,防止重放攻击。

  4. 金融交易:在金融交易中,current timestamp 记录交易时间,确保交易的准确性和可追溯性。

  5. 文件管理:文件的创建、修改和访问时间都依赖于 current timestamp,帮助用户管理文件的生命周期。

  6. 在线服务:许多在线服务,如在线会议、直播、订票系统等,都需要 current timestamp 来管理时间敏感的操作。

current timestamp 的挑战

尽管 current timestamp 非常有用,但也存在一些挑战:

  • 时区问题:不同时区的 current timestamp 可能导致误解或错误,因此需要统一时间标准。
  • 精度问题:在某些应用中,毫秒或微秒级别的精度可能不够,需要更高精度的时间戳。
  • 同步问题:在分布式系统中,确保所有节点的时间同步是一个复杂的任务。

结论

current timestamp 在现代信息技术中扮演着关键角色,它不仅是时间的记录者,更是系统运行、数据管理和安全认证的基石。通过了解和正确使用 current timestamp,我们可以更好地管理数据、提高系统的效率和安全性。无论是开发者、系统管理员还是普通用户,都应该对 current timestamp 有一定的了解,以便在日常工作和生活中更好地利用这一技术。

希望通过本文的介绍,大家对 current timestamp 有了更深入的理解,并能在实际应用中灵活运用。